d'Yquem

Chateau d'Yquem is a name synonymous with luxury, excellence, and timeless elegance. Situated in the Sauternes appellation of Bordeaux, Chateau d'Yquem has been producing its renowned sweet wines since the late 16th century. The estate was elevated to the unique status of Premier Cru Supérieur in the 1855 Bordeaux Wine Official Classification, a distinction that underscores its unmatched quality and prestige. The estate encompasses 113 hectares of vineyards, primarily planted with Sémillon (75%) and Sauvignon Blanc (25%). The unique terroir, characterized by its gravelly soil and the influence of the Ciron and Garonne rivers, creates the perfect conditions for the development of noble rot (Botrytis cinerea). This natural phenomenon concentrates the sugars and flavors in the grapes, resulting in wines of extraordinary richness, complexity, and longevity. Chateau d'Yquem's Grand Vin is legendary for its opulence, balancing sweetness with acidity and displaying layers of exotic fruit, honey, and spice. The estate also produces a dry white wine, Y d'Yquem, which showcases the estate's versatility and the quality of its Sauvignon Blanc and Sémillon grapes. Both wines are made with the same meticulous attention to detail, ensuring that each bottle reflects the estate’s commitment to excellence. The history of Chateau d'Yquem is as rich as its wines. The estate has seen numerous owners over the centuries, including the Lur-Saluces family, who managed it for over 200 years. Today, Chateau d'Yquem is owned by LVMH, and under the leadership of Pierre Lurton, it continues to thrive, producing wines that are benchmarks of quality and luxury.
